Andreas Reinhold / reiniandClaude Opus 5 f307079a45 Name the monospace faces once, as a typeface token and md-mono
Both applications show values a person reads or types character by
character: SealShare's share tokens and recovery codes, ReStride's file
and folder names and its keyboard shortcuts. The package wrote the
platform's monospace stack twice (the reset's <code>, <kbd>, <samp> and
the mono field) and gave everything else nothing, so an app copied the
stack by hand. --md-ref-typeface-mono now holds it, read by the reset,
the field and a new md-mono text class; the guard points font-mono at
<code> or md-mono. Not an M3 token: M3 names a brand and a plain
typeface and nothing for code. Decided with the user (plan step 46).

Andreas Reinhold / reiniandClaude Fable 5.1 5b0ca26857 Sample the springs over M3's web durations, and add the Standard scheme
bin/springs.mjs is the sampler behind motion.css: damping ratio and stiffness in,
the 49-point linear() and the settle time out. Run with --settle it reproduces
the six curves the file carried byte for byte, so only the window changed.

Each spring is now sampled over the duration M3 publishes for the web (spatial
350/500/650 ms, effects 150/200/300 ms) instead of stopping at its own settle
time, so the *-duration tokens read Google's numbers. Sampling stays in real
time — point i is the spring at duration × i / 48 — so the bounce lands at the
same millisecond as before; a longer duration just holds the tail flat at 1, and
a shorter one pins the last point, at most 0.3% of the travel in one frame. Each
token's comment records damping, stiffness, settle time and sampled duration.

M3's second motion scheme is here too: [data-motion="standard"] swaps the three
spatial springs (damping 0.9, 0.2% overshoot instead of 9%) and their durations;
the effects springs sample identically in both schemes, so they are shared. The
reduced-motion block names both selectors, so it still zeroes every duration.

Plan: docs/plans/material-3-alignment.md step 5, findings core C8, C9.

Andreas Reinhold / reiniandClaude Fable 5.1 2feb623ec0 Take the typescale's tracking from Compose, and reset roundness
Tracking now comes from androidx's TypeScaleTokens.kt as sp/16 rem, so Display
Large is -0.0125rem, Title Medium and Body Medium 0.0125rem where material-web's
pre-Expressive numbers stood. The emphasized set gets its own
--md-sys-typescale-emphasized-<style>-tracking, which the emphasized utilities
read: M3 widens four of them and takes Display Large back to zero. Every regular
utility sets `font-variation-settings: normal`, because the property inherits and
body copy inside an emphasized heading is meant to read as itself.

bin/check-font.mjs (fontkit) prints the packaged woff2's fvar axes, so a
re-subset cannot silently drop the ROND axis the emphasized styles depend on;
`npm run check:font` runs it and tests/Feature/FontTest.php runs it through the
configured node binary, skipping when node cannot run (PHP cannot open a woff2
without Brotli).

Plan: docs/plans/material-3-alignment.md step 4, findings core C5, C6, C7.

Andreas Reinhold / reiniandClaude Fable 5.1 25ff5a8d71 Key breakpoints, scales, inks and states on M3's tokens
Tailwind's sm…2xl are cleared for M3's window size classes (medium 600, expanded
840, large 1200, extra-large 1600; resources/js/breakpoints.js for scripts), and
its radius, shadow, text-size, weight, leading, tracking and easing scales are
cleared like its palette, so only M3's utilities compile. The semantic inks are
roles rather than opacities (M3 reserves 38% for disabled). state.css declares
M3's state opacities as tokens, adds the dragged layer and a touch-target utility.
Plan: docs/plans/material-3-alignment.md, steps 1, 2, 3 and 8.
